Join our Facebook group

👉 Remote Jobs Network

Senior PHP Developer, Laravel

June 3

Apply Now
Logo of Interaction Design Foundation (IxDF)

Interaction Design Foundation (IxDF)

The Interaction Design Foundation is the world's largest online design school globally with over 150,000 graduates.

A Global Community of the World's Best Designers • UX Design • Courses • Online courses • Online learning

11 - 50

Description

• You'll collaborate with senior developers, UI/UX designers, content and product leads, and our founders. Your main responsibilities will be to: • Contribute to the development of the back-end for interaction-design.org, encompassing new features, occasional refactorings, and infrequent bug fixes • Write maintainable and clean back-end code, including our open-source packages • Engage with cross-functional teams to refine specifications for new features and enhancements • Maintain up-to-date documentation for all developed and modified code (MD + mermaid.js) • Consistently expand test coverage using PHPUnit and cypress.io, with a preference for TDD • Proactively engage in refactoring processes to reduce technical debt, aiming for an optimal developer experience • Review peers' code submissions, utilizing PR reviews as a knowledge-sharing and problem-solving tool • Participate in planning, stand-up, and workshop video calls, enjoying 3 meeting-free days weekly for focused work • Frequently deploy your code with multiple daily releases (incrementally ship features using feature flags)

Requirements

• You possess expert knowledge in PHP and frameworks like Laravel or Symfony • Your professional experience with OOP spans over 6 years, grounded in a robust understanding of computer science fundamentals, from data structures to design patterns • You are an engineer, not a frameworker. You embody an engineer’s mindset and are always curious about the mechanics behind the scenes • You are enthusiastic about learning by doing and are committed to putting in the effort to continuously improve your skills • You speak and write acceptable English – not perfect English, just acceptable – since you will be working with people from all around the world • You value teamwork and prioritize collaboration, focusing on collective goals and harmony in the workplace • You are self-motivated and self-disciplined and thus work well in a flat hierarchy with lots of freedom • You love to have creative freedom, make independent judgments, and live up to the responsibility that comes with that freedom • You are driven by the desire to make a positive impact in the world and to meaningfully improve the lives of others • You get bonus points… if you have expertise in TDD, DDD, Event Sourcing, and CQRS • if you hold a Master’s Degree in Computer Science • If you possess strong skills in database management, including scaling and optimization • if you have experience with Vue 3 and/or Angular • if you have experience building mobile apps • if you have experience with technologies such as Stripe, Swoole, Customer Data Platforms, or Analytics tools • if you have contributed to open-source projects (you will join a team of Laravel/framework contributors)

Benefits

• A founder and CEO who is also a developer, understanding your challenges and triumphs • A zero-effort development environment based on Docker, streamlining your workflow • The opportunity to refine and develop battle-tested guidelines for JS and CSS • Access to a comprehensive library of books and courses, ensuring your skills and knowledge remain at the forefront • A full-time position, within a fully remote organization. Daily video-based contact with your colleagues from elsewhere on the planet, and you’ll get to meet them on team trips 1–2 times per year. • Forget fluffy titles, political agendas and corporate drama. Your colleagues value your character, work ethic, and what you actually achieve. Junior or senior, if you embody old-school virtues of always striving to become the best version of yourself, you'll thrive at the IxDF. • Work with a highly scalable impact-driven model where we’ve consistently created more than 50% growth year-on-year since 2013. Bootstrapped with zero investment capital but built purely on consistency over time and the conviction that affordable design education can improve the quality of life of humankind. • Work in a company where the distance between idea and execution is minimal. We’re a highly agile organization with zero bureaucracy or corporate politics – but with a high level of orderliness and efficiency. • Have the chance to feel the impact of helping an ever-growing design education brand empower and enrich the lives of millions of people. • Work in a company culture where idealism meets high performance and excellence. To help us improve the world (and yourself in the process), you’ll need grit, work ethic, long-term thinking, and self-discipline. • Work with people who have a hands-on attitude and a bias towards action as opposed to fluff-filled, unrealistic strategies. You’ll need crisp execution skills yourself and the ability to impress your colleagues with concrete results, just like they’ll impress you.

Apply Now
Built by Lior Neu-ner. I'd love to hear your feedback — Get in touch via DM or lior@remoterocketship.com